§ 152.150 SPECIAL USE.
   (A)   (1)   Special uses may include, but are not limited to, public and quasi-public uses effected with the public interest, uses which may have a unique, special or unusual impact upon the use or enjoyment of neighboring property, and planned developments.
      (2)   A use may be a permitted use in one or more zoning districts, and a special use in one or more other zoning districts.
   (B)   The following uses of land or structures, or both, may be permitted in any use district, subject to the provisions of this chapter:
      (1)   Airport, landing field, or landing strip;
      (2)   Areas for the dumping or disposal of trash or garbage;
      (3)   Bus terminal, railroad passenger station, or any other transportation terminal facilities;
      (4)   Cable television control station or plant;
      (5)   Cemeteries, crematories, or mausoleums;
      (6)   Churches and accessory buildings used for religious teaching;
      (7)   Golf courses, public or private;
      (8)   Hospitals, care centers, or sanitariums;
      (9)   Institutions for the care of the mentally handicapped;
      (10)   Municipal or privately owned recreation building or community center;
      (11)   Nursery schools, day nurseries, and child care centers;
      (12)   Parking area, public;
      (13)   Police stations, fire stations or place for storage of municipal equipment;
      (14)   Public administration building, auditorium, gymnasium, or any other publicly-owned structure;
      (15)   Public or private park or playground;
      (16)   Public utility facilities (i.e., filtration plant or pumping station, heat or power plant, transformer station, and other similar facilities);
      (17)   Radio and television antenna towers, commercial;
      (18)   Railroad right-of-way;
      (18)   Schools, public or private; and
      (19)   Telephone exchange.
   (C)   A special use shall be permitted only after a public hearing before the Board of Appeals with prior notice thereof given in the manner as provided in § 152.153 (A) and (B).
   (D)   A special use shall be permitted only upon evidence that such use meets standards established for such classification in the ordinances, and the granting of permission therefor may be subject to conditions reasonably necessary to meet such standards.
   (E)   Any proposed special use which fails to receive the approval of the Board of Appeals shall not be approved by the City Council except by a favorable majority vote of all aldermen of the city then holding office.
   (F)   A planned unit development may only be constructed in an R-2 General Residence District upon issuance of a planned unit development special use permit as provided in §§ 152.165 and 152.165.
